OVERVIEW

PostgreSQL is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by marcelo-ochoa. It ranks #26944 of 58,900 servers tracked on MCP Toplist, and its repository has 2 GitHub stars. PostgreSQL is listed on PulseMCP, and ships as a single rolling release with no explicit version metadata. It was first listed on Mar 7, 2025.
